A cross sectional study also known as a cross sectional analysis or transversal study is a type of observational study that analyzes data collected from a population or a representative subset at a specific point in time that is cross sectional data. In medical research social science and biology a cross sectional study also known as a cross sectional analysis transverse study prevalence study is a type of observational study that analyzes data from a population or a representative subset at a specific point in time that is cross sectional data.
